Anywho – Kelly is unbothered by it all and is moving forward. The singer just landed a seven-figure deal [a little over 1 million dollars] with a new fashion company called “Next”.

The Next deal is currently being negotiated by British entrepreneur Chris Nathaniel and his company, NVA Entertainment Group, and according to an insider, “It’s a massive deal but NVA are used to securing seven-figure deals.

 

NVA Entertainment has yet to release a statement confirming the joint venture or the contractual fee but it’s quite clear that the two will indeed be working with one another.
